===ISU-152=== [[File:Bagration_mood_70.png|thumb|right|300px|A platoon of ISU-152s advances, screened by a company of [[Emcha]]s. One assault gun has been taken out.]] <section begin="isu152" />Зверобой (Zveroboy, lit. beast killer) was a modernisation of the [[Kliment Voroshilov tank#SU-152|SU-152]], created to update the design, since the production of the [[Kliment Voroshilov tank#KV-1S|KV-1S]] chassis used for the old design was coming to an end. The new assault gun, IS-152, based on the superior IS tank chassis, mounting the ML-20S 152mm howitzer inside a spacious casemate. After trials revealed a number of deficiencies, the design was revised and upgraded, resulting in the ISU-152, accepted for production. Although it mounted an even more powerful gun than the [[Iosif Stalin tank#IS-2 obr. 1943|IS-2]], the lack of a turret allowed it to conserve weight and the end design was only a ton heavier than the base tank. It had thicker forward armor and was also cheaper to build. All of these made it an exceptional weapon in a variety of roles, including supporting assaults, urban combat, and destroying enemy tanks. That last role was the source of its nickname, as the ISU-152 could destroy any German tank at range, or at least maul it severely, while remaining safe from return fire. The only drawback was a low rate of fire, which precluded its use in a traditional tank destroyer role. Despite that, it was one of the most versatile and powerful tools in the [[Soviet Union|Soviet]] arsenal, and the ISU-152 remained in production and service into the 1960s, with a total of 4 635 vehicles produced.<section end="isu152" /> * [[ISU-152]]: The basic tank. ** [[ISU-152 (Fin)]]: A captured unit pressed into Finnish service. {{-}}
